Research Abstract |
In this study, we examined the factors influencing to population genetic structures of three harmful algal bloom causing microalgal species in Japanese coastal waters. The population genetics analysis by use of highly polymorphic microsatellite markers strongly suggested that population expansion and new introduction in Alexandrium tamarense and Heterocapsa circularisquama has occurred by gene flow through human-assisted dispersal, namely transfers of vegetative cells via translocation of the Japanese oyster and Japanese pearl oyster's spats. In Alexandrium catenella, we obtained negative data in the population genetic study to proof the human-associated introduction from Japan to Thau lagoon (French coasts in Mediterranean Sea).
